Highways Electrician

Repair, maintenance, replacement, and installation of all associated illuminated street furniture which includes but not restricted to lighting columns, traffic signs, bollards and feeder pillars.

Carrying out various tasks within the titled role ensuring that all H&S & Quality objectives and responsibilities are adhered.

ACCOUNTABILITIES      Diagnose and repair faults on all types of highways illuminated street furniture as required.

Carry out Street Lighting Electricity at Work Testing Programme, which involves performing underground and above ground cable tests, in-line with laid down standards and good industry practice.

Erect and maintain all street lighting apparatus in accordance with Industry Standards and the legal requirements of the Electricity at Work Regulations 1989 and the IEE Wiring Regulations 18th Edition. 

Complete comprehensive test and Inspection Certificates to the company Test Specification.

The electrician will be responsible for the operation of a small stock on the vehicle of lamps, tubes, photo electric cells, cut-outs, ignitors, capacitors etc.

Capable by means of training and accreditation to remove DNO fuse carrier from street lighting installation.

Locate fault, by use of specialist equipment, on underground cable network, excavate and repair cable.

Drive and operate tower vehicle working within the safe operating limits of the mechanical boom.

Carry out regular vehicle and lifting equipment checks and report any defects for repair.

Working knowledge of first aid procedures following exposure to burns or electric shock.

Tasks could include tree pruning or making safe roofing or other parts of buildings.

Assist DNO linesmen and cable jointers when working on street lighting tasks.

All electricians are to be contactable by mobile telephone for emergency works such as road accidents, lamp knockdowns, live cables, etc.

Erect and dismantle festive decorations, festoon lighting and external trees.

Maintain high-mast lighting installations.

Maintain floodlighting installations, derived from a 3-phase supply.

Install and remove insulated shrouding to the REC overhead network, as and when required.
